Australia's openers are doing well not to let any opportunity go by. Ball drops short as Warner pulls it powerfully over midwicket for a four. In the next over, he turns Woods fine for another four as Australia continue to slowly but steadily increase the scoring rate.

Wood makes the breakthrough with the key wicket of Warner, who is caught behind for 21.

The fast bowler gets one to slant across the left-hander who has a poke but gets the edge and wicketkeeper Jos Buttler completes an easy catch.

Steve Smith gets a beauty first up as Wood gets one to go straight on, going past the edge of the bat.
